Over 1 million foreigners including refugees live in Istanbul: Governor
There are a total of 1.18 million foreigners in Istanbul, including 535,000 Syrians under temporary protection, Governor Ali Yerlikaya has said.

Greece says EU must abide by its migration commitments to Turkey
Europeans must honor their commitments to Turkey as part of a migration deal signed in 2016, the Greek minister for migration and asylum said on Oct. 4.
Notis Mitarachi said the EU-Turkey migration deal must be implemented by both sides to manage the refugee flows and stem illegal trafficking in the Aegean Sea.
Elderly population to rise significantly in next four decades, says expert
An expert projects that the share of the elderly population in Turkey's total population will reach the same level in Europe in 2060 given the current trajectory of the fertility rate in the country.
The fertility rate represents the ratio between the average number of live births in a year and the number that a woman would have during her childbearing years - the 15-49 age group.
Bulgarians and EU Citizens Will Enter UK only with Passports from October 1st
As of October 1, 2021, Bulgarian citizens can enter the UK only with an international passport, which must be valid for the entire period of the planned stay.
Exception will be made only for those who have received the so called "settled status" in UK.
Citizens who do not present such a document will not be allowed in the country.

Japanese Over Age of 65 Will Soon Pass 30% of Population
The share of people over the age of 65 in Japan reached a record 29.1 percent of the total population, according to official data released today.
The figure has been gradually increasing since the end of World War II. In 1950, for example, the elderly were 4.9 percent of the population, in 1985 - 10 percent, and in 2005 - over 20 percent, recalls TASS.
